How will you preserve philipine literature?

Preserving Philippine literature is essential to safeguard the country's cultural heritage and ensure future generations can appreciate and learn from the work of Filipino authors and writers. Here's how we can preserve Philippine literature:

1. Digitization: Convert physical copies of literary works into digital formats such as e-books, PDFs, and online archives. This makes literature more accessible and allows it to be shared easily across different platforms.

2. Online Platforms: Create and maintain online platforms dedicated to Philippine literature, where readers can find and read literary works, author biographies, and critical analysis.

3. Libraries and Archives: Establish and support libraries and archives specifically for Philippine literature, ensuring the proper storage and organization of literary materials.

4. Education: Integrate Philippine literature into the curriculum of schools and universities to ensure students are exposed to and appreciate the works of Filipino authors.

5. Reading Programs: Promote reading programs and book clubs that encourage people to read and discuss Philippine literature.

6. Literary Journals and Magazines: Support and contribute to literary journals and magazines that publish Filipino writers and their work.

7. Republishing: Reprint out-of-print and rare literary works to ensure their continued availability.

8. Translation: Translate Philippine literary works into other languages, making them accessible to a wider global audience.

9. Awards and Recognition: Establish awards and recognize Filipino authors and writers, providing incentives and motivation for literary creation.

10. Events and Festivals: Organize literary festivals, book fairs, and public readings to celebrate Philippine literature and bring together readers and writers.

11. Oral Tradition: Document and preserve oral literature such as folk tales, epics, and poetry, which may not be traditionally written down.

12. Community Engagement: Encourage local communities to participate in preserving and promoting Philippine literature by collecting and sharing stories, poems, and songs from their regions.

13. Public Awareness: Raise public awareness about the significance of Philippine literature, emphasizing its role in cultural identity, history, and social development.

14. Collaboration: Collaborate with cultural institutions, universities, and governments to implement large-scale preservation initiatives that ensure the long-term protection of Philippine literature.

15. Copyright Protection: Ensure proper copyright protection for literary works to prevent unauthorized reproduction and promote respect for intellectual property.

By implementing these strategies, we can preserve the richness and diversity of Philippine literature for generations to come, allowing Filipinos to continue to draw inspiration and cultural understanding from the works of their talented writers.
